[mailop] Proofpoint Block Issues

2021-04-12 Thread Zachary Sverdrup via mailop
Hi All,
We are running into an issue where two of our IP ranges are being
randomly(we believe) listed at Proofpoint for the last 3-4 weeks. We have
reviewed the client sending out of these ranges and have submitted a few
tickets and emailed their postmas...@proofpoint.com email a few times with
no response.

About 60% of the time when we get these alerts we are checking within 5
minutes on their site and they are not showing us as being blocked. We will
get 15+ notifications in 10 minutes with not a single one actually being
listed and then other times we will be listed briefly and then removed.

We have gone through and reviewed multiple clients but cannot figure out
why our entire ranges keep getting blocked. Has anyone seen this before or
have any idea what we can do about this?
